About Lifecare ASA

https://lifecare.no/

Lifecare ASA is a clinical-stage medical sensor company specializing in the development of nanotechnology for medical applications. Its core activity involves creating miniaturized, implantable, and long-term nanobiosensors for the continuous monitoring of various body analytes. The company's primary focus is on developing a sensor for correct and continuous glucose monitoring to improve diabetes management. The business model is based on developing and licensing its proprietary sensor technology to facilitate the production and sale of advanced medical devices.
